PLEASE HELP DUE IN 3 HOURS Think of a sport not usually considered to be dependent on muscular strength and endurance, like golf
WINSTONCH [101]

Answer:

In comparison to other sports, tennis is often deemed a sport that is not dependent on muscular strength/endurance. Nonetheless, an athlete's performance in tennis could be improved by increasing both muscular strength and endurance. Tennis relies on the players ability to get from one side of the court to another, ready to hit the ball with strength and intent to their opponent's side of the court. With low endurance, tennis is near to impossible to play as you have to run back and forth nearly the whole time.
